Size

Bunk beds are an excellent solution to save space, whether you're decorating a guest room or sharing a bedroom with your children. The size of the bunk bed you pick will depend on the number of people that will sleep in it. Triple, triple loft, and L-shaped bunks are best suited to larger bedrooms as smaller rooms can accommodate twin over full bunks, or standard bunk beds. Some beds can be split into two lofted beds for more versatility.

The frame of a bunk bed is typically constructed of solid wood, it's important to consider how much weight each bed will hold. Solid-wood bunk beds are sturdy enough to support the mattress and the weight of many people. Additionally you should make certain that the bunks are rated for safety and built with sturdy materials.

The thickness of the top bunk bed mattress is crucial when determining the correct height. The mattress's thickness should not exceed 6 inches to ensure it fits within the guardrails and does not expose the quadruple sleeper bunk bed to danger.

Many bunk bed designs have an escalator or ladder, but you can also pick futon bunk beds that features a lower couch-sized mattress. This design is ideal for dorms or apartments with small spaces. It's also a great method of making the most of your limited space.

Another option is an over full bunk bed that has the full size mattress on both the bottom and top. This is a popular choice for families with children of various ages who need to share a bedroom. The extra mattress on the bottom bunk can aid in easing the transition of a child to a regular adult-sized bed, and it can also make room for a single bed in a smaller bedroom.

Some models of bunk bed come with a trundle which can be pulled out to accommodate guests. This makes the bunks more functional for adults, since it provides guests with a cozy place to stay overnight without clogging the main bedroom. The trundle beds are usually constructed of beautiful wood and can be customized to include drawers to provide additional storage.

Safety

It might appear to be a fun bed for your kids however, there are safety issues. The majority of injuries caused by a bunk bed are head injuries and falls. Toddlers are more prone to these types of injuries because they lack the thinking skills necessary to make safe decisions. Falls from the top bunk may cause fractures and concussions.

To reduce the risk, place your bunk beds away from heaters, ceiling fans, and windows (especially their cords). You should also make sure that there is sufficient space around the bunk bed for children to climb and descend safely without assistance from an adult. If you are able, think about choosing the corner bunk bed because this could help reduce the risk further by forming a barrier on two sides.

It is also important to choose the correct ladder for your bunk bed. Ladders must be narrow enough that children can't climb them in a dangerous way. They should also be safe for children, so your children can use them without difficulty. Ideally, you should store the ladder away until it is required to sleep, as leaving it out in the open could increase the risk of accidents.

In the same way, you should keep items like scarves, necklaces and jump ropes from the guard rails of the top bunk since they could be strangulation hazards. If you have to put them up, you should place them near the edges of the top bunk to stop children from reaching them.

Also, make sure that you follow the manufacturer's directions carefully when assembling your bunk bed. This will ensure that the bolts, nuts, and other fasteners that are on your bed aren't loose. They could pose a danger to your children. You can also lay carpet under your bunk bed to decrease the risk of a head injury in the case of an accident.

Once you have your bunk bed in place, set rules regarding the use of it for your children. Remind them on a regular basis to help them develop the habit of being secure at all times. Make sure that all friends who visit your children understand and comply with the rules in order to minimize the risk of accidents.

Storage

Bunk beds with storage are ideal for rooms with shared children and can help you organize your child's bedroom. Many come in different designs and finishes. They also offer a variety of storage options. These features include drawers shelves, and cabinets. These features make bunks ideal for storing clothing, bedding and other personal things. They also allow you to save money by reducing number of separate pieces of furniture for your bedroom.

A lot of modern bunk beds come with a trundle that can be used to sleep overs. The trundle bed is generally placed beneath the bunk bed that is lower. It can be folded up whenever needed, or put away when not in use. There are a few trundle beds that are set close to the floor, and others rise to the same height as the bed on top. If you don't wish to purchase the trundle bed option, opt for a loft bunk with additional drawers or shelving.

A bunk bed with a desk is another option to make the most of storage space. These units can be installed on either the bottom bunk or the top bunk and are ideal for children who must do schoolwork and homework. The desk can be lowered when not in use to be in a flush position with the benches and folds down to form a mattress for sleeping. Some bunks with desks have an L-shaped shape to fit into small spaces without taking up too much floors.

A few of the other storage options for bunk beds are under bed drawers as well as a woven basket. Under bed drawers for bunk beds are very popular because they offer plenty of storage that is accessible from the bottom bunk. They are ideal for storing sheets, blankets and seasonal clothing. They are ideal for storing books and toys. These drawers often feature wheels that let them move in and out of the bunk beds with ease without scratching the floor.

Another popular solution for bunk bed storage is a woven basket. The beds come with a large basket that is attached to the sides of one of the bunks. They have plenty of room for books, clothing and other personal belongings, and they're woven from natural materials that give them a unique appearance.
